Explosions in Syria kill at least 11

Massive explosions rocked the Hama military air base in western Syrian early on Friday afternoon, killing at least 11 pro-Assad regime fighters, according to the UK-based Syrian Observatory for Human Rights.

Syrian state media confirmed that blasts were heard coming from the base, but made no comment on casualties or the cause of the explosions. There are conflicting reports as to what set off the blasts, which sent a huge plume of grey smoke into the air above the base.

“Five blasts at least were heard inside Hama military airport. The explosions struck several regime depots of weapons and fuel at Hama military airport,” the Observatory said.
